THE MORNING AFTER - a post-premiere gathering after «The Trojan Women».
On May 20, the team behind the performance will come together with audiences, media, members of the cultural community, and friends of the project to talk about a production that unexpectedly became one of the most discussed theatre premieres of this spring.
«The Trojan Women» is a Ukrainian adaptation of the legendary production by New York’s La MaMa Experimental Theatre Club, previously presented in more than 30 countries worldwide. In Ukraine, this story was reimagined through chorus, movement, rhythm, and an invented language - without traditional dialogue or classical dramatic structure.
